Fig. 1.

Design of the HAM mask for the Keck OSIRIS Imager. Subapertures that are combined in one or more interferograms have the same color. Top: subaperture combinations and baselines of the HAM mask. Bottom: monochromatic simulation of the HAM PSF with indications of the location of the resulting interferogram(s). The HAM mask incorporates a SAM mask design as the central component (leftmost panels) and adds a holographic component with off-axis interferograms (other panels). The baselines of the central component have been omitted for clarity.
